With the development of the aerospace industry, the high performance, high reliability, and low cost of advanced aircraft, launch vehicles, and satellites are largely due to the widespread application of new materials and processes.
Advanced composite materials are an important part of high-tech aerospace products. Continuous CF/PEEK composites offer extremely high heat resistance (heat deflection temperature up to 340°C), corrosion resistance, friction resistance, and good biocompatibility. They effectively reduce the structural weight of aircraft, launch vehicles, and satellites, increase payload and range, and lower costs.
Continuous CF/PEEK composites possess very high mechanical properties, while also offering higher impact resistance than traditional thermoset composites. They can be used to process aircraft landing gear skin components, while also reducing aircraft weight.

Applications in the Civil Aviation Sector
CF/PEEK composites are widely used in the leading edges of civil aircraft wings, as well as internal aircraft parts including seat frames, brackets, beam ribs, and intake pipes.

Applications in the Aerospace Sector
PEEK prepreg has been used for fully automatic tail units, fuselage belly panels, fuselage skins, nose landing gear doors, main landing gear doors, wing panels, and horizontal stabilizer leading edges. As wave-transparent materials, PEEK, PEKK, PES, and other resins have good radar transmission and electrical insulation properties. When radar waves strike these resin-based composites, creeping electromagnetic waves are not easily formed. Unidirectional reinforced grades made from hybrid carbon fiber and PEEK multi-filament yarns are suitable for manufacturing helicopter rotors and some important shell components.

Advantages of Continuous Carbon Fiber CF/PEEK Composites:

 

1. Good Elongation at Break and Fracture Toughness

As a representative high-performance thermoplastic polymer, PEEK has a fracture toughness of up to 2.0 kJ/m, which is 20 times that of epoxy resin.

2. Excellent Delamination Resistance and Fatigue Resistance

PEEK has good impact resistance, making it one of the most impact-resistant heat-resistant resins. At the same time, PEEK has high rigidity, good dimensional stability, a low coefficient of linear expansion, and excellent long-term creep and fatigue resistance.

3. Excellent Chemical Corrosion Resistance

PEEK has outstanding chemical corrosion resistance, showing strong resistance to acids, alkalis, and almost all organic solvents. It is only corroded by halogens and strong acids at high temperatures, and at room temperature it is only soluble in concentrated sulfuric acid.

4. Excellent Hot and Humid Resistance

PEEK has low moisture absorption and good hot and humid resistance, maintaining good mechanical properties even under high temperature and high humidity. In addition, it has outstanding hydrolysis resistance, low moisture absorption and permeability, and resistance to steam, water, and seawater.

5. Excellent Sliding Wear and Fretting Wear

PEEK can maintain high wear resistance and a low friction coefficient at 250°C.

6. Biocompatibility

Studies have shown that when short carbon fiber reinforced PEEK is used as a prosthetic material implanted in animals, it has low cytotoxicity, meets the cytotoxicity standards for medical implant materials, and has good blood and tissue compatibility.

7. X-ray Translucency

PEEK has good transmission properties and does not produce artifacts like metal implants do under X-ray or CT examinations, facilitating medical checkups and other examinations for patients.
